Meet The Class of 2010 - William


One of the unique attributes of the DeVos Sport Business Management Program is the network of students who make up our program. Our class will take every course together during our tenure here at UCF and we will work on countless group projects and collaborative efforts. As a result of our shared interests in the business of sport, a natural team camaraderie is formed. However, our team is composed of people from diverse backgrounds, experiences and ambitions. We offer profiles of class members to give you an idea as to the type of people who make up our program, individuals who collectively will be leaders in sport and society and will be teammates for life.


Name: William Johnson
Hometown: Louisville, KY
Undergraduate College: The Florida State University
Undergraduate Major: Business Management

Current Graduate Assistantship or Employment: G.A. in the Institute for Diversity and Ethics in Sports (TIDES)

Future Career Goals: Working in professional soccer and eventually moving up to the ownership level.

Reasons For Choosing DeVos: The program stands for ethics, diversity, leadership, and community. The community aspect is very unique and the professors are good, positive role models.
